Amazon EKS and Amazon EKS Distro now supports Kubernetes version 1.32
News
Amazon has announced support for Kubernetes version 1.32 in Amazon Elastic Kubernetes Service (EKS) and Amazon EKS Distro.
- New clusters can now be created using Kubernetes 1.32
- Existing clusters can be upgraded via EKS console, eksctl, or infrastructure-as-code tools
- Support available in all AWS Regions, including AWS GovCloud (US) Regions
- Key improvements include stable support for custom resource field selectors
- Removes v1beta3 API version of FlowSchema and PriorityLevelConfiguration
- EKS Distro builds available through ECR Public Gallery and GitHub
Users can use EKS cluster insights to check for potential upgrade issues and review version lifecycle policies in the documentation.
